The Client Solutions team owns our client relationships, leading communication of Kepler’s strategic guidance and ensuring that internal teams meet and exceed clients' goals. They’re home to ad operations, campaign project management, and overarching client planning.

The Client Solutions Manager will be a leader on key client relationships. In this critical role, you’ll be responsible for deeply understanding clients’ business issues and goals, becoming the trusted “go to person” for clients. You’ll succeed as a CSM if you’re a proven leader, have exceptional communication and quantitative skills, and are a creative problem solver with a deep understanding of today’s digital ecosystem.

What You Will Do:

  • Be an expert in leveraging digital media channels for maximum impact – including display (programmatic and direct), mobile, search, social and online video, among others
  • Act as the primary point of contact for assigned clients; escalate, track and solve client issues
  • Partner with clients to understand their business goals, marketing objectives, and competitive constraints
  • Lead your team through campaign design and setup – including media strategy, media buying and ad operations - and oversee reporting and analytics for assigned clients
  • Monitor and manage all aspects of daily client campaign performance
  • Lead on-site and remote client strategy and status meetings
  • Manage a team of Client Solution Senior Analysts and/or Analysts, and serve as internal client to other Kepler functional teams

Desired Skills and Experience:

  • 3-5+ years of experience in digital advertising account management, yield optimization, marketing strategy/consulting, or brand management
  • Experience with marketing campaign design, campaign management, and analysis
  • Ability to apply innovative thinking to solve complex client marketing challenges
  • Strong analytical skills; must be comfortable with MS Excel, data analysis, and internet technologies
  • Strong ability to create, build and leverage relationships
  • Ability to lead day-to-day client relations, and work with management and multifunctional teams to respond to client needs
  • Excellent listening, presentation, and written and verbal communication skills
  • Effective time management skills; ability to prioritize and meet deadlines
  • Ability to contribute to fast-paced, entrepreneurial, team-based environment
  • Bachelor’s degree with relevant major preferred

Total Compensation:        

  • Base Salary: $85,000 - $106,300
  • Target Annualized Discretionary Bonus: 10% ($8,500 - $10,600)
  • Target Total Cash: $93,500 - $116,900

Benefits:

  • Healthcare/Dental/Vision
  • Unlimited PTO
  • 401k Contributions
  • $100/mo Wellness Stipend
  • $125/mo Mobile Phone Stipend
  • $50/mo Internet Stipend
  • $200/yr Home Office Equipment Stipend
  • $800/yr Annual Learning Stipend
  • $1,500/yr Annual Education Stipend
  • Parental Leave - 16 week primary caregiver / 6 week secondary caregiver leave
  • Annual Work From Anywhere 4 weeks per year
